NEW! 2010 License Renewal and Continuing Education Requirements

The Real Estate Commission is changing the staggered renewal periods for licensees to even-year renewal cycles with the transition beginning in 2010 - 2012.

For real estate licensees who are currently on a two-year renewal cycle, 2008 - 2010, nothing has been changed and they are expected to complete eight-hours of continuing education prior to June 30, 2010.

For real estate licensees who renewed May and June 2009 they were issued a one-year license with an expiration date of June 30, 2010. This annual license was issued to bring licensees to an even-year renewal cycle. For licensees on this one-year renewal cycle they will be required to accrue four (4) hours of continuing education prior to June 30, 2010.

The four hours of required continuing education may consist of any Commission approved continuing education course(s) (core and/or elective).

The goal of this transition is to have licensees on an even-year renewal cycle which will bring uniformity to the renewal and continuing education process.  


The Real Estate Commission has gathered renewal information from licensee files in hopes of aiding individuals in determining the amount of continuing education due by June 30, 2010. Ultimately, it is the responsibility of the licensee to confirm the accuracy of this information by previous financial records in their possession such as cancelled checks and statements associated with renewing, reinstating or reactivating their real estate license.
